The Essence of Acceptance

Acceptance is the cornerstone of living life "As It Is." It's about acknowledging the reality of our circumstances without trying to change them forcibly. This doesn't mean giving up on growth or improvement; rather, it's about not allowing our happiness to be contingent on conditions being different. When we learn to accept our lives as they are, we open ourselves up to a profound sense of peace and contentment. This acceptance also extends to self-acceptance, which is crucial for personal development and self-esteem.

The Power of Presence

Living "As It Is" also means being fully present in the moment. The present is the only time we truly have control over, and by focusing on it, we can make the most out of every situation. Presence allows us to experience life more deeply, to engage with our surroundings, and to appreciate the small joys that we might otherwise overlook. It's about letting go of past regrets and future anxieties, and immersing ourselves in the now.

Embracing Imperfection

Perfection is an illusion, and the pursuit of it can be exhausting and ultimately unfulfilling. Embracing life "As It Is" is to embrace imperfection, both in ourselves and in the world around us. It's about recognizing that flaws are a natural part of being human and that they can often lead to growth and learning. When we stop striving for an unattainable ideal, we free ourselves to enjoy life's journey with all its ups and downs.

The Challenge of Letting Go

One of the most challenging aspects of living "As It Is" is the process of letting go. Letting go of control, expectations, and the desire to manipulate outcomes requires a great deal of trust and courage. It's about surrendering to the flow of life and trusting that things will unfold as they're meant to. This doesn't mean being passive; it's about taking action when necessary but doing so without attachment to a specific result.

Finding Joy in Simplicity

There's a unique joy that comes from appreciating the simple things in life. When we live "As It Is," we learn to find happiness not in grand achievements or material possessions, but in the everyday experiences that make life rich and fulfilling. It could be the warmth of the sun on our skin, a shared laugh with a friend, or the quiet moments of reflection. Simplicity brings a clarity and focus that can often be lost in the complexity of modern life.

The Journey Towards Mindfulness

Mindfulness is intrinsically linked to living life "As It Is." It's about being aware of our thoughts, feelings, and sensations without judgment. Mindfulness practices, such as meditation and deep breathing, can help us cultivate this awareness and bring us back to the present moment. Through mindfulness, we can navigate life with a sense of calm and resilience, even in the face of adversity.

The Impact on Relationships

Our relationships can benefit greatly from the philosophy of "As It Is." When we accept people as they are, without trying to change them, we foster a deeper connection and understanding. This acceptance can lead to more authentic and meaningful relationships, as it encourages openness and vulnerability. By letting go of unrealistic expectations, we can build stronger bonds based on mutual respect and appreciation.
